Mike Leach should be the number one target to replace Turner Gill at Kansas. With Gill being fired over the weekend, Kansas needs someone like Mike Leach. The fact is that Kansas football program is bleeding money. The Jayhawks need a big time hire to excite the fan base and ignite interest in Kansas Football. Besides, a Mike Leach coached Kansas team versus a Tommy Tuberville Texas Tech team would be a must see game.
So, why would Leach be interested in Kansas? The answer is that he wants to get back into coaching and Kansas is in a BCS conference. The fact that it is in the Big 12 is just a bonus. Unlike what is expected at Texas Tech, Leach could probably get away with not doing very much in terms of kissing babies or chatting up donors. Kansas has always been a big time basketball school and Bill Self would probably take the lead on the fundraising front. Going to Kansas would also give Mike Leach yet another chance to prove just how brilliant a coach he really is. Of course most people have already figured that out after seeing what has happened at Texas Tech since Leach left.
Without a doubt, there will be some discussion of the baggage that Mike Leach would bring with him. It should be a non factor. Here is what should be a factor. The next time realignment rears its ugly head, Kansas would be advised to have a football program that people want to watch and can make inroads in the Kansas City market. Yes Leach is different kind of guy, yes Leach speaks his mind, but he wins football games and puts people in the stands.
The other big selling point for Mike Leach is that he does not have to have more talent than the other team in order to win. During his ten year run at Texas Tech he was known for getting more out of his players than almost anyone else. The last six times Mike Leach faced Oklahoma he was 3-3, so he was breaking even against Oklahoma with players that Oklahoma did not even want. Even though Kansas does not have elite talent, they should have enough talent for Leach to win with.
Kansas fans obviously want Mike Leach. Mike Leach wants back into coaching. Now it is time for the Kansas administration to get this thing done.
